Skip to content

Instantly share code, notes, and snippets.

@suchja
Last active June 15, 2017 08:50
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save suchja/21b37110abc7f9f7525e5444f8c7399d to your computer and use it in GitHub Desktop.
Save suchja/21b37110abc7f9f7525e5444f8c7399d to your computer and use it in GitHub Desktop.
Der Quellcode zum C# Tutorial Deutsch in dem ich zeige wie du die ToString-Methode verwendest um den Zustand eines Objektes auszugeben - https://youtu.be/g71JndA-0qA
using System;
namespace ObjekteAusgeben
{
class Computer
{
public string ZugeordneterMitarbeiter { get; set; }
public int GeraeteId { get; set; }
public DateTime Anschaffungsdatum { get; set; }
public override string ToString()
{
string resultat = $"Geräte-Id: {GeraeteId}" + Environment.NewLine;
resultat += $"Zugeordneter Mitarbeiter: {ZugeordneterMitarbeiter}" + Environment.NewLine;
resultat += $"Computer angeschafft am: {Anschaffungsdatum}";
return resultat;
}
}
class Program
{
static void Main(string[] args)
{
Computer meinComputer = new Computer();
meinComputer.GeraeteId = 1;
meinComputer.ZugeordneterMitarbeiter = "Jan von LernMoment.de";
meinComputer.Anschaffungsdatum = DateTime.Now;
Console.WriteLine("Ausgabe meines Objektes des Klasse Computer");
Console.WriteLine(meinComputer);
Console.WriteLine("Bitte 'Enter' drücken zum beenden!");
Console.ReadLine();
}
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ment